Oct. 7, 1871

9836. H.M. Chief Clerk

RECEIVED

344

Ather Under Secretary of State for Foreign Affairs & presents his compliments to the Under Secretary of the Colonies, and begs to inclose, the inclosures to the Foreign Office letters of the 22nd August and 18th September last, respecting levy of Opium Duty at the Chinese Stations in the neighbourhood of Hongkong, as requested in the Note from the Colonial Office of the 5th instant.

Foreign Office, October 6. 1871.
